Transaction 150e801e4d2485dc5649ec7960f0c4a3f668d8da2912200a430f7a889c4bf8d8

1 Input
2 Outputs
  • 150e801e4d2485dc5649ec7960f0c4a3f668d8da2912200a430f7a889c4bf8d8:0
  • value  793087376
    address  37juZKPs7GRvCSKcZcyfZzVjU5uFGMe1kQ
  • 150e801e4d2485dc5649ec7960f0c4a3f668d8da2912200a430f7a889c4bf8d8:1
  • value  186318136
    address  3KppJ4z1vPb5qfsyYxTFRWCBhAdbDCV2R4